Overview
GR-50 variable frequency speed regulation double-decked Glass Reaction Kettle is a equipment produced by GREATWALL for material synthesis, distillation, condensing and other experiments. The kettle body has an inner and outer structure, which can adjust the material temperature in the kettle by injecting circulating liquid into the interlayer, and can work under normal or negative pressure conditions.
Features
1. Made of high borosilicate Glass, it has excellent physical and chemical performance.
2. Operating temperature range, can be used in the range of -80 ℃ to 200 ℃.
3. Can work under normal pressure and negative pressure conditions, Vacuum Level can reach 0.095 MPa, and the pressure range in the kettle is -0.1 MPa to 0 MPa.
4. A plug or discharge valve made of Teflon + FV rubber, and an "O" ring with a TFE protective layer.
5. Stirring motor adopts frequency conversion speed regulation, Speed range is 50~ 500rpm.
6. Adopt the design of the discharge valve without liquid accumulation, and the effective size of the discharge valve from the ground is 320mm.
7. The temperature sensor is stainless steel surface polytetrafluoroethylene to achieve double anti-corrosion; the stirring adopts mechanical sealing, the propelling Impeller, and the shaft is stainless steel outer polytetrafluoroethylene.
Principle
The Reaction Kettle adjusts the temperature of the material in the kettle by injecting a circulating liquid at a certain temperature into the interlayer of the double-decked kettle body. The uniform dropwise addition of the material can be controlled by adjusting the constant pressure funnel or the regulating valve on the feeding bottle. The heat exchange function of the condenser can be used for distillation to recover the reaction product. The Reaction Kettle can be pumped to a negative pressure state as needed to meet the experimental conditions.

Steps
1. According to the experimental requirements, inject a certain temperature of circulating liquid into the interlayer to adjust the temperature of the material in the kettle.
2. If negative pressure conditions are required, pump the kettle to the required vacuum state.
3. By adjusting the constant pressure funnel or the regulating valve on the feeding bottle, control the material to be evenly dripped into the Reaction Kettle.
4. Start the variable frequency speed stirring motor and set the required Rotation speed for stirring.
5. If the product needs to be recycled by distillation, use the condenser for heat exchange.
6. After the reaction is completed, the material is discharged through the discharge valve on the side without liquid accumulation.
Notice
• Operating temperature is within the allowable range of -80 ° C to 200 ° C.
The operating pressure should not exceed the specified range of vacuum or atmospheric pressure (MPa), and the pressure range in the kettle is -0.1MPa to 0MPa.
• Note that the temperature difference between the inside and outside of the jacket should not exceed 90 ° C.
• Please check whether the power supply specification is 220-240V~, 50/60HZ before use.
• When operating, please pay attention to the Dimension of the whole machine (900 * 690 * 2050mm) and the effective size of the discharge valve from the ground (320mm) to ensure the safety of the operating space.
• Do not use non-compliant media to avoid damage to borosilicate Glass, Teflon + FV rubber, PTFE and other materials.
